Rotary Club takes on outdoor spring cleaning

May 15, 2025

MIDDLEBORO Members of the Middleboro/Lakeville Rotary Club recently completed a cleanup and landscaping project at the John F. Glass Square “Island,” a traffic island the club has adopted for ongoing maintenance.

Volunteers spent several hours at the site, removing debris, planting flowers and spreading mulch as part of a seasonal revitalization effort.

“The cleanup was not just about aesthetics,” said club member Kevin Quackenbush. “It was about creating a space that residents could appreciate — a symbol of unity and the positive impact of collective action.”

The project is one of several community service activities organized by the Rotary Club throughout the year. The organization frequently supports local initiatives through volunteer work, with a focus on public spaces, events and partnerships with area organizations.

The club adopted the island several years ago and returns regularly to maintain the area. Quackenbush said the work is part of their mission to support community engagement through service.
